Distortions Filtering

◦ tunnel vision

tendency to look at only one element of a situation

positives are discounted negatives are counted

Overgeneralization◦ conclusion based on a single event or piece of evidence

includes global labels for people and places◦ e.g., jerk, stupid, etc.◦ contains a grain of truth◦ ignores all contrary evidence

Schema◦ mental structures that guide behaviour◦ influences what we see and remember◦ sometimes called rules or beliefs◦ a product of previous learning
